Latest Patents

One of Shippy's latest patents focuses on differential filtering of genetic data. This innovative software provides functionality for users conducting experiments aimed at detecting and identifying genetic sequences and other characteristics of genetic samples. The software allows users to interact with a graphical user interface that visually represents the genetic information obtained from experiments. The methods and software developed by Shippy are essential for bioinformatics and biological data analysis. They enable users to differentially filter complex genetic data by varying genetic parameters, allowing for the removal or highlighting of specific regions of interest, known as CytoRegions. This capability enhances the analysis and visualization of genotyping data, making it a valuable tool for researchers in the field.
